stringutil

问题描述:stringutil和stringutils的区别是什么? 大家好,小编来为大家解答以下问题,stringutils要引入哪个包,stringutils.isblank和isempty,现在让我们一起来看看吧!

StringUtil.isEmpty和StringUtil.isBlank的区别

stringutil的相关图片

org.apache.commons.lang.StringUtils类是用于操作Java.lang.String类的,而且此类是null安全的,即如果输入参数String为null,则不会抛出NullPointerException异常。StringUtils类中有130多个静态方法,都可以通过如下方式调用:StringUtils.xxx()。

常用方法简介:1. public static boolean isEmpty(String str) 。判断某字符串是否为空,为空的标准是 str==null 或 str.length()==0。

1、服务器测试工具包(Server Test Toolkit, STT)是专为服务器应用程序测试所设计一套工具,项目本身属于开源项目。对于基于linux等服务器应用程序的测试而言,存在诸多相似的手段:比如检查日志、查询数据库等,这些公用的功能可以抽取出来作为一套工具以实现高复用,因此这套工具立足于此。

2、这套工具将根据日常公用需求持续完善和添加功能,希望给更多从事服务器应用程序的测试人员提供帮助,当然也希望更多的人参与研发,为提高软件质量做出微薄贡献!。

Java中的 StringUtil.validate() 的用处是什么,为什么不同类型的数据都用这个方法判断?的相关图片

Java中的 StringUtil.validate() 的用处是什么,为什么不同类型的数据都用这个方法判断?

1. public static boolean isEmpty(String str)。

判断某字符串是否为空,为空的标准是 str==null 或 str.length()==0。

下面是 StringUtils 判断是否为空的示例:

StringUtils.isEmpty(null) = true。

StringUtils.isEmpty("") = true。

StringUtils.isEmpty(" ") = false //注意在 StringUtils 中空格作非空处理。

StringUtils.isEmpty(" ") = false。

StringUtils.isEmpty("bob") = false。

StringUtils.isEmpty(" bob ") = false。

2. public static boolean isBlank(String str)。

判断某字符串是否为空或长度为0或由空白符(whitespace) 构成。

StringUtils.isBlank(null) = true。

StringUtils.isBlank("") = true。

StringUtils.isBlank(" ") = true。

StringUtils.isBlank(" ") = true。

StringUtils.isBlank("\t \n \f \r") = true //对于制表符、换行符、换页符和回车符。

StringUtils.isBlank() //均识为空白符。

StringUtils.isBlank("\b") = false //"\b"为单词边界符。

StringUtils.isBlank("bob") = false。

StringUtils.isBlank(" bob ") = false。

if (StringUtil.nullTrim(ninushiName).equals(

if (StringUtil.nullTrim(ninushiName).equals("")) { 这句话是什么意思?

你弄错了吧 ,这个应该是封装好的工具类了,是别人写好方法在这个类里面了。

比如

public class StringUtil{。

public static boolean validate(Object obj){。

//对obj操作...。

return true;。

}

js判断一个字符串中出现次数最多的字符,统计这个次数的相关图片

js判断一个字符串中出现次数最多的字符,统计这个次数

根据我的经验,StringUtil.nullTrim(ninushiName) 将实现字符串 ninushiName 中的空格去掉,如果ninushiName 是 null的话,转换为空字符串 "";

if (StringUtil.nullTrim(ninushiName).equals(""))。

意思是, 当 ninushiName 去掉空格后的值是等于 ""(空字符串)时,执行以下代码。

if(!StringUtil.isEmpty(id)&&(selected == null || selected.length <= 0))

var

stringUtil

{},

max

0;

stringUtil.getMaxLengthCharacter。

function(s)

var

getObj,

info

{},

getMaxLength;

/*

把字符和出现次数存放在对象中

*/

getObj

(function(s)

var

0,

s.length,

obj

{};

for

(i

0;

<

j;

i++)

if

(!obj[s[i]])

obj[s[i]]

1;

else

obj[s[i]]

+=

1;

return

obj;

})(s);

/*

找出最长的个数

考虑到一个字符串中的最大长度可能不止一个,所以,这里需要找出最大数。

*/

getMaxLength

(function()

var

max

0,

//好歹也出现0次

i;

for

(i

in

getObj)

if

(getObj[i]

>=

max)

max

getObj[i];

return

max;

})();

for

(var

in

getObj)

if

(getObj[i]

===

getMaxLength)

info[i]

getObj[i];

return

info;

};

//

调用

var

res

stringUtil.getMaxLengthCharacter('aaabbbccc');。

window.console

&&

console.log(res);。

原文地址:http://www.qianchusai.com/stringutil.html

smartron-100

smartron-100

congenital-50

congenital-50

lw/蚊子叮咬的小红点,蚊子叮咬小红点怎么治疗

lw/蚊子叮咬的小红点,蚊子叮咬小红点怎么治疗

馣馤是佛香,鹡鸰香珠是什么

馣馤是佛香,鹡鸰香珠是什么

LEM-70

LEM-70

indice-60

indice-60

capitalize-30

capitalize-30

cc/奥特曼沙雕头像男生,奥特曼沙雕头像 初代

cc/奥特曼沙雕头像男生,奥特曼沙雕头像 初代

openwrt网页打不开,openwrt有些网页无法打开

openwrt网页打不开,openwrt有些网页无法打开

花开淡墨痕,我家池头洗砚树,个个花开淡墨痕

花开淡墨痕,我家池头洗砚树,个个花开淡墨痕

三国志战略版攻城拔寨攻略大全 - 最新阵容搭配与技巧分享 三国志战略版关妹三势阵攻略 - 关银屏最强阵容搭配指南 三国志14战法大全 - 完整战法系统解析与使用指南 三国志战略版 一骑当千 - 策略战争手游,重现三国乱世 三国志战略版新手体验官 - 官方活动专题页 三国志战略版夏日炎炎 - 火热夏日活动专题 三国志战略版乐府有必要建造吗?深度分析攻略 - 三国志战略版攻略站 三国志战略版同盟军令攻略 - 军令系统详解与奖励指南 三国志战略版造币厂配置攻略 - 最优资源分配指南 三国志战略版高建势力值攻略 - 快速提升势力值技巧 三国志战略版功能性减伤规避攻略 - 完整机制解析与实战技巧 三国志战略版 先锋体验官 - 率先体验最新版本,赢取专属福利 三国志战略版高级建筑分配方案 - 最优布局攻略 三国志战略版10级势力值攻略 - 势力值提升指南 三国志战略版虎帐有必要吗?深度解析虎帐功能价值与使用建议 三国志战略版先锋体验官招募 - 抢先体验最新版本,赢取专属福利 三国志战略版军屯地产量计算器 - 最全军屯地产量数据与攻略 三国志战略版调兵和驻守攻略 - 军事部署完全指南 三国志战略版控制效果全解析 - 游戏攻略专题 三国志战略版坐守孤城推荐 - 最佳阵容搭配与战术攻略 三国志战略版治疗率计算器 - 精准计算武将治疗能力 三国志战略版 - 夏侯渊 夏侯惇 郭嘉武将攻略 | 三国武将详解 三国志战略版怎么提升名声上限 - 完整攻略指南 三国志战略版乐府建造攻略 - 建造指南与技巧 三国志战略版虎杖要不要用 - 虎杖武将使用攻略三国志战略版虎帐建造条件 - 完整攻略指南 三国志战略版新手兑换码大全 - 最新可用兑换码合集 三国志战略版S3阵容搭配大全 - 最强阵容推荐与攻略 三国志战略版测试服申请 - 抢先体验最新版本 三国志战略版高建分配策略指南 - 资源优化与建筑优先级